NetApp Certified Implementation Engineer – NFS, ONTAP — Question 9
Your IT company is using NetApp FlexClone on a two node AFF cluster with 20TB of data to rapidly provision environments for each developer.
Each environment is replicated to an eight node AFF C-Series cluster at a DR site using SnapMirror. You notice that the environments are consuming significantly more disk space on the destination cluster than on the source cluster.
In this scenario, which action will minimize the disk usage on the destination cluster?
Answer options
- A. Consolidate the SnapMirror destination volumes onto a single aggregate.
- B. Distribute the SnapMirror destination volumes evenly across the available aggregates.
- C. Enable SnapMirror network compression.
- D. Enable Flexclone copies on the DR side.
Correct answer: D
Explanation
Enabling FlexClone copies on the DR side allows for the efficient use of storage by creating space-efficient clones of the original data, which in turn minimizes disk usage. The other options either do not directly address the issue of disk space consumption or may not result in the same level of efficiency as using FlexClone.
